Transaction 8f51ec852b75d54d4026331f686975ecfa6642ee4ba701c1ce8878730cdb0883
2 Input
2 Outputs
- 8f51ec852b75d54d4026331f686975ecfa6642ee4ba701c1ce8878730cdb0883:0
- 8f51ec852b75d54d4026331f686975ecfa6642ee4ba701c1ce8878730cdb0883:1
value 732783
address 18k9kBg6oKQD2dN3YMcASKuBugK7X3MRAr
value 1095520
address 3CtPvuHXWvNoHZyTRPzCPwUidhd4rPWqtH